Jazz in the City, a staple on First Fridays in downtown York, was put on hiatus during the height of the pandemic, but now it's back! Performances will continue each First Friday throughout the 2021-2022 season.
Percussionist Jeff Stabley, adjunct faculty and instructor of Jazz Studies, Percussion, and Improvisation at York College, is at the helm once again as the Artistic Director of this monthly ensemble of talented local and regional musicians eager to perform live once again.
December's concert will feature:
Tim Warfield - sax
Tony Miceli - vibraphone
Steve Meashey - bass
Jeff Stabley - drums
